In effect, the breast does not develop harmoniously because the implant base is not symmetrical in relation to the areola.<br \/>\nBreast hypotrophy or hypertrophy<br \/>\nAbnormally high sub mammary fold<br \/>\nAbnormally large mammary-areolar plaque<\/p>\n<h3>Stadium:<\/h3>\n<p><strong>Stage I:\u00a0<\/strong>This is the most common form, with only the inferomedial segment absent. The areola looks inwards and downwards. Areolar protusion may be present.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Stage II :\u00a0<\/strong>The entire lower half of the breast is absent. The areola looks down.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Stage III:\u00a0<\/strong>The upper and lower segments may be absent. In this case, the mammary base is completely narrowed, and the breast takes on a tube-like shape.<\/p>\n<h3>Objective:<\/h3>\n<p>To regain harmonious breasts, we can combine a glandular plasty, a breast lift or a breast reduction.\u00a0<a title=\"BREAST AUGMENTATION\" href=\"https:\/\/www.sylvaindavid.com\/en\/chirurgie-seins\/augmentation-mammaire\/\">breast augmentation<\/a>a breast lift and a\u00a0<a title=\"BREAST AUGMENTATION BY FAT TRANSFER\" href=\"https:\/\/www.sylvaindavid.com\/en\/chirurgie-seins\/augmentation-mammaire-graisse\/\">grease transfer<\/a>. There are many techniques available to the plastic surgeon.<\/p>\n<p>He or she should explain the advantages and disadvantages of each technique during the consultation. Generally speaking, if the deformity concerns a major anomaly in the base of the breast implant, a fat transfer is the best way to remedy this malformation and restore harmony to the breasts.<\/p>\n<p>If the gene concerns breast hypotrophy, breast augmentation by prosthesis may be desirable.<\/p>\n<p>In the case of significant ptosis, a breast lift is required.<\/p>\n<p>All these techniques can be combined to obtain the best results.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\t\t<\/div> \n\t<\/div> <\/div><\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_column vc_column_container vc_col-sm-12\"><div class=\"vc_column-inner\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><\/div><\/div><\/div><div class=\"wpb_column vc_column_container vc_col-sm-12\"><div class=\"vc_column-inner\"><div class=\"wpb_wrapper\"><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"Tuberous breasts: Composite breast augmentation Tuberous breasts correspond to a breast malformation.
